The bulldozer market was valued at US$ 15.9 Billion in 2025 and is projected to reach US$ 31.05 Billion by 2034, expanding at a CAGR of 7.72% during 2026–2034. Demand is being shaped by earthmoving intensity across construction, mining, infrastructure, agriculture, forestry, and defense applications, where operators require durable traction, precise grading, and higher utilization from crawler and wheeled machines.

North America continues to be one of the most attractive operating regions for the bulldozer market size on the back of fleet renewal, highway upgrades, mining overburden applications, and power plant site preparations. This region is expected to register a 6.8-7.4% CAGR during 2026-2034, primarily led by the US and Canada due to the adoption of telematics, grade control, and cleaner engines by contractors.

Bulldozer Market Analysis

The main factors responsible for driving growth in the bulldozer market are public infrastructure rehabilitation, open-pit mining, and industrial site development. Machines have to be able to clear, push, rip and grade through unstable ground while keeping machine availability high. Additionally, increased demand is seen in cases where time frames for projects are shortened by road authorities, utilities, port authorities and renewable energy companies.

The value chain is made up of steel forming, powertrain procurement, hydraulics, undercarriage, blades, dealer network, rental operations, and after-sales services. The supply environment is still vulnerable to engine supply, electronics, logistics, and the cost of steel. The demand side in the bulldozer industry becomes more dependent on manufacturers with reliable components and local service delivery due to its direct impact on mine production, efficiency, and penalties.

The competition is focused on OEMs with strong crawling technology, an extensive network of dealerships, and advanced technologies. Among those, companies like Caterpillar Inc., Komatsu Ltd., Deere & Company, CNH Industrial N.V. and Zoomlion Heavy Industry Science and Technology Co., Ltd. will compete based on productivity, connectivity of their fleets, and assistance to operators. Chinese and specialized manufacturers will compete on price, exportation, and robust machinery.

The bulldozer market analysis reveals that investments are centered around automation, electric drive systems, emission reduction engines, and service lifecycle. Strategic positioning varies by region; where premium companies focus on reliability and digital control, value-based companies are catering to public contractors and small fleet owners. The factors of dealer finance, used equipment sales, and rentals are now critical since buyers are now looking at the cost per hour of operation.

Segmentation Analysis

Product Type

Product Type is growing at a 7.3–8.1% CAGR during 2026–2034 as buyers choose between crawler traction and wheeled mobility. The bulldozer market scope is shaped by terrain conditions, cycle time, haul-road quality, and jobsite versatility. Crawler models dominate heavy-duty pushing, while wheeled designs serve road maintenance, stockyards, and operations requiring faster repositioning.

  • Crawler Bulldozer remains the dominant product because tracks deliver high traction, stability, and pushing force on uneven terrain, making it essential for mining, land clearing, infrastructure grading, and forestry work.
  • Wheeled Bulldozers serve operations where mobility, faster travel speed, and reduced surface damage matter, including ports, stockyards, municipal works, and road maintenance projects with firm operating surfaces.

Type

The Type segment is anticipated to grow at a 7.0–7.8% CAGR from 2026 to 2034 in the bulldozer market. This is due to varying requirements for equipment on account of the size of the site and material handling. The small type dozer handles small sites and landscaping, whereas the medium-sized dozer is both productive and mobile, while the large one tackles mining and infrastructure projects.

  • Small Dozers are recommended for use on residential sites, in landscaping, agriculture, and utility applications where flexibility of operations, reduced transport costs, and ease of operation are more important than maximal drawbar pull.
  • Mid-Size Dozers are the most versatile type for contractors due to their combination of grading, ripping, and reasonable costs of ownership for road, commercial, quarry, and mid-scale construction projects.
  • Large Dozers play a critical role in mining, damming, port and corridor development due to their high blade capacities, durable undercarriages and prolonged duty cycles.

Blade Type

Blade Type is advancing at a 7.1–7.9% CAGR during 2026–2034 as users configure machines for material retention, grading accuracy, and productivity. Blade selection determines pass efficiency and fuel use, especially in high-volume earthmoving. U-blades support bulk pushing, Semi-U blades balance penetration and carry, and Sigma Dozer designs improve material flow in specialized applications.

  • The U-blade is extensively used for high-volume material pushing owing to its curved wings that hold the material, such as soil, coal, or overburden, effectively.
  • The Semi-U blade combines both the properties of penetration and carrying, which makes it appropriate for use in various construction, road building, and land development applications.
  • The Sigma Dozer is designed for highly efficient pushing by enhancing the rolling and loading characteristics of material, making it possible for the operator to minimize material spillage.

Applications

Applications are growing at a 7.8–8.6% CAGR during 2026–2034 as bulldozers remain core machines across construction, mining, military, agriculture, infrastructure, and forestry. Each application values different attributes, including pushing force, mobility, protection, and attachment compatibility. Infrastructure is a high-growth application because public investment creates sustained grading, clearing, and embankment work.

  • Construction requires constant supply from residential, commercial, and industrial areas that require clearance of land, rough grading, and spreading of materials through dependable equipment before the excavation, foundation, and paving operations.
  • Mining uses crawler dozers for overburden removal, haul-road maintenance, management of stockpiles, and preparation of pits, and thus the robustness and availability of the dozer matter a great deal in their acquisition.
  • The military uses sturdy dozers for engineering operations, route clearance, and obstacle preparation, among others.
  • In agriculture, dozers are used for leveling, irrigation channels, farm roads, and clearing, particularly when tractor force and traction become inadequate.
  • The strategic importance of the infrastructure sector arises due to the requirement of heavy earthmoving work for roadways, railways, ports, airports, power, and utility projects, which need large-scale earthmoving during the initial stages of construction and regular maintenance.
  • The demand for forestry arises from the need for constructing access roads, creating fire lines, removing stumps, and land rehabilitation.

Bulldozer Market Growth Drivers and Impact Analysis

Infrastructure Corridors and Urban Land Development

Roads, railways, ports, airfields, and utility installations by governments provide a consistent need for earthworks prior to concrete and steel installation. Bulldozers find application in clearing, embankment shaping, subgrade preparation, and maintenance of haul roads, thus qualifying as front-end machines in projects' execution. This driver finds relevance especially in cases where contractors have more than one corridor in construction, requiring machines that can adapt from rough pushing to accurate grading. This is also a favorable environment for rentals since government projects do not require permanent asset investments. Growth in the pipeline of civil infrastructure will positively influence the bulldozer industry through replacement, increased usage, and adoption of grade control technology.

Mining Expansion and Critical Minerals Activity

The mining industry relies on the use of bulldozers in order to remove overburden, control dumps, clean the pit floors, and build haul roads. The need for such machinery is increasing due to the growing demand for energy transition metals, steel products, coal in certain geographical locations, and aggregates, which need to be extracted from the surface of the earth and require expansion of sites. Machine reliability plays an important role in increasing the efficiency of a mining site since any downtime may disrupt truck cycles and material flow. It becomes necessary for miners to use large-sized dozers with robust undercarriages and blades, as well as remote monitoring capabilities.

Technology Adoption to Reduce Operating Cost

Telematics, machine control, assisted steering, payload management, and predictive maintenance are some examples of technologies being adopted by contractors in an attempt to enhance the economics of their projects. Bulldozers use a lot of fuel and work in harsh conditions; even little improvements in pass efficiency, idle time, and maintenance schedules will make the process more economical for them. Technology also helps overcome the shortage of operators through automation of operations and improved visibility on-site. This leads to a transformation in the purchasing strategy from "horsepower purchasing" to "productivity purchasing."

Bulldozer Market Future Trends

Electrified and Hybrid Dozer Platforms

Electrification will become a defining theme in the bulldozer market trends as regulators, public owners, and large contractors push lower-emission jobsites. Battery-electric adoption will initially suit compact and mid-size machines working in urban, tunneling, landfill, and municipal environments where noise and exhaust restrictions are stricter. Hybrid and diesel-electric architectures may scale faster in large dozers because they can reduce fuel burn while preserving duty-cycle endurance. The transition will require charging infrastructure, thermal management, and dealer capability, creating opportunities for partnerships between OEMs, battery suppliers, utilities, and rental companies seeking differentiated low-emission fleets.

Autonomous Earthmoving and Connected Fleets

With respect to self-operating capabilities, dozers will move from dozers with the assistance of blades and guiding of paths to doing dozing operations in repetitive mining, quarries, and infrastructure projects. Thanks to fleet connectivity, it will become easy to operate dozers, excavators, graders, and haul trucks without necessarily having to create idle periods between them. The adoption of this technology will depend on the accuracy of sensors, site mapping, cybersecurity, and the adoption of the operators. These will be the first organizations to adopt this technology owing to their ability to justify high upfront costs in the bulldozer market.

Bulldozer Market Opportunities

Aftermarket Services and Predictive Maintenance Packages

Aftermarket services offer a scalable opportunity because bulldozers operate under abrasive loads that accelerate wear in undercarriages, blades, hydraulic systems, and powertrains. OEMs and dealers can expand revenue by bundling inspections, remote diagnostics, rebuild kits, wear-part subscriptions, and uptime guarantees. Customers benefit from predictable maintenance budgets and reduced unplanned downtime, especially in mining and infrastructure fleets. This opportunity aligns with bulldozer market forecasts because installed-base growth through 2034 will increase demand for parts and service intensity. Suppliers that combine digital monitoring with local parts availability can capture value even when new-equipment cycles soften.

Rental Fleet Expansion in Emerging Economies

Rentals provide a good option in situations where contractors do not have sufficient capital but would require modern machines to undertake project work. In countries like India, Southeast Asia, Gulf countries, and infrastructure corridors in Africa, there is a demand for rentals of crawler and mid-sized machines. Differentiation could be provided through training of operators, maintenance, and the use of telematics to monitor machine utilization. OEMs will gain since their new machines would reach smaller contractors through the rental business and there would be predictable replacement schedules of the fleet of rental machinery.
